Uploaded image for project: 'Ambari'
  1. Ambari
  2. AMBARI-17615

AMS metrics GET API does not work for same metric with multiple aggregation functions

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Resolved
    • Critical
    • Resolution: Fixed
    • 2.4.0
    • 2.4.0
    • ambari-metrics
    • None

    Description

      AMS API which used to work in previous versions is now broken in 2.4.0 version

      GET http://<host>:6188/ws/v1/timeline/metrics?metricNames=bytes_in._min,bytes_in._max,bytes_in._sum,bytes_in._avg&appId=HOST&precision=hours&startTime=1466928000000&endTime=1467439200000&hostname=<host>
      
      failed. Status:400
      {
      "exception": "BadRequestException",
      "message": "java.lang.Exception: Multiple aggregate functions not supported.",
      "javaClassName": "org.apache.hadoop.yarn.webapp.BadRequestException"
      }
      

      This impacts SmartSense capture

      Attachments

        1. AMBARI-17615-2.patch
          21 kB
          Aravindan Vijayan

        Issue Links

          Activity

            People

              avijayan Aravindan Vijayan
              avijayan Aravindan Vijayan
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: